Forester Edward Brackenburye is best known for his skill as an archer. He has held the Baronial archery championship three times, in 1998, 1999, and 2000. He was N. Oaken Regional Champion and Kingdom Archery Champion. He has been elevated to the Greenwood Company (our Kingdom's highest honor for archery) and continues to encourage archery in the barony both as an archer and marshal. His heavy weapons fighting has spanned over 10 years and he has held the position of Champion d'arms in 2000. He is a member of House Nosse Eldesar, and is Squired to Sir William Ransome. His other interests include calligraphy, illumination, wood working, the bagpipes, late 15th century England (War of the Roses), and making his garb. He has served the Barony and the North Oaken Region as minister of Arts and Sciences and was our 3rd Baron with his lady, Milesent Vibert as his Baroness.
